Who are Glenn and Abraham in "The Walking Dead"?

Glenn Rhee and Abraham Ford are two characters in the AMC television series "The Walking Dead," based on the comic book series of the same name. Glenn is a former pizza delivery boy known for his resourcefulness and agility. Abraham is a former U.S. Army sergeant who is initially introduced as a hardened survivor.

Glenn and Abraham are both important members of Rick Grimes' group of survivors. Glenn is a trusted friend and ally to Rick, and he often serves as the group's scout and supply runner. Abraham is a valuable asset to the group due to his military training and experience. He is also a skilled tactician and strategist.
